Pokemon movies, anime episodes, eSports content and so much more exist. In fact, there’s so much video content related to the franchise that The Pokemon Company created Pokemon TV.

Pokemon TV

Pokemon TV is an app that is now available for the Nintendo Switch. According to Nintendo, “Pokémon TV is a fun way to watch all sorts of great Pokémon programming!

Enjoy the adventures of Ash, Pikachu, and their friends, along with animated specials and highlights of Pokémon Championship tournaments”. The content will change “periodically”.

But that’s not all.

The app even includes a category that appeals to the franchise’s younger fans. Nintendo says on the app’s eShop listing page that “the Junior category includes videos to entertain younger Trainers. Kids can join in with sing-along songs, hear popular nursery rhymes, and more”.

Pokémon TV is a free video service provided by The Pokémon Company International that provides select episodes of the Pokémon anime to viewers. It was first accessible  in November 2010. It can be viewed through the internet with a web browser, by downloading the free “Pokémon TV” app on the App Store for iOS (with Chromecast support) and tvOS (Apple TV 4th generation), on Google Play for Android (with Chromecast support), on the Amazon Appstore for the Amazon Fire TV, on the Roku Channel Store for Roku devices, and now also on the Nintendo Switch eShop.
